Output 148e17b763b717a107116ed296c197a1f7efb654a3943bd1601ff84dec58823c:1

value
1597133
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7636ab523b365f969bb09cf397fdb2488fed956e OP_EQUAL
address
3CU59fTtuVpvo7ij4rB1fnoK1aa3hHE7Cs
transaction
148e17b763b717a107116ed296c197a1f7efb654a3943bd1601ff84dec58823c
spent
true